Immigrants from Senegal vs Nigerian 5th Grade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 90,130,297 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Senegal and percentage of population with at least 5th grade education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.167 and weighted average of 96.8%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 332,724,627 people shows a substantial positive correlation between the proportion of Nigerians and percentage of population with at least 5th grade education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.529 and weighted average of 96.9%, a difference of 0.090%.
